Supporting employee benefits internationally

Managing employee benefits across multiple countries can be challenging. Statutory requirements, employee expectations and provider markets vary significantly between locations, making it difficult to maintain a consistent approach. Our employee benefits consultancy helps organisations:

  • Design harmonised benefit strategies that reflect company culture across multiple locations.
  • Adapt benefit programmes to meet local legislation and employee expectations.
  • Benchmark providers and benefit offerings to ensure value and cost-effectiveness.
  • Communicate benefits clearly so employees understand and engage with the support available to them.

According to CIPD, 2024 80% of multinationals say employee benefits are one of the most challenging aspects of global expansion.

Typical Employee Benefits include:

  • Private Medical Insurance (PMI): Comprehensive healthcare cover for employees.
  • Life Assurance: Provides financial protection for employees’ families.
  • Income Protection: Safeguards income if employees are unable to work long-term.
  • Pension Schemes: Supports financial wellbeing and retirement planning.
  • Employee Assistance Programmes (EAPs): 24/7 confidential counselling and support.
  • Wellbeing Benefits: Options such as gym memberships, counselling, or flexible lifestyle perks.
